Dataset description

Description of site suitability for the installation of near-surface geothermal heat collectors in 1-2 m floor depth based on the soil map 1:25,000 (BK25) of Schleswig-Holstein. The ground units are divided into the classes well suited, suitable and not suitable. The method description is stored in Georeports 19, LBEG (potential location suitability for geothermal heat collectors). The calculation is available for about half of the country. For the other half, the corresponding datasets of the BK25 are missing. The ground map 1:25,000 is not continued.
